The ‘Energy Now’ display shows you how much
electricity you’re using right now in either Watts or
Kilowatts. Test it out by switching an appliance,
such as your kettle, on and off and watch the figure
change.
The ‘Cost Per Day/Month’ display shows how much
you’re forecast to spend on electricity over these
periods of time. You'll also see this change as you
turn appliances on and off as it shows how much
your electricity will now cost if you continue to use
this amount. Remember, 5% VAT is added to your
electricity bill which the monitor doesn't take in to
account.
